    WAYNE COUNTY SCHOOLS

    JOB DESCRIPTION

    Position: Speech/Language Pathologist

    Evaluated by: Principal/Assistant Principal

    Job Description: The Speech/Language Pathologist is assigned to deliver a comprehensive instructional support program to students with speech and language impairments in accordance with state law and West Virginia Board of Education and county policies and regulations.

    Qualifications: Holds or qualifies for a West Virginia Professional Service Certificate endorsed for speech/language pathology.

    Length of Employment: 200 Days

    Responsibilities: The Speech/Language Pathologist shall have the following responsibilities and duties:

    • To plan, develop and implement programs that facilitate speech/language services to students.
    • To gather and interpret data relevant to speech/language services for students.
    • To provide speech/language therapy to identified students.
    • To communicate effectively with other professionals and parents/guardians.
    • To screen and evaluate students for possible placement in speech/language therapy.
    • To assist in the referral of students.
    • To serve on the Student Assistance Program team as appropriate.
    • To perform sweep screenings of kindergarten and other new students for detection of speech/language problems.
    • To discuss the purpose and procedures used in the screening process with parent/guardian upon request.
    • To observe referred students in class.
    • To discuss the child's progress/problem with referral source.
    • To discuss screening/evaluation results and recommendations with school personnel and parent/guardian.
    • To file all required plans and reports with the Office of Special Programs.
    • To serve on Placement Advisory Committee(s) to interpret speech/language test scores and make recommendations.
    • To write Total Service Plan (TSP) with required data and prioritized goals for students who will be receiving special services.
    • To communicate placement/non-placement recommendation with school personnel and parent/guardian.
    • To confer with parent/guardian in the writing of the implementation plan and secure parent/guardian's signature.
    • To provide consultative services for speech/language impaired students on a regular basis.
    • To provide on-going staff development to teachers of students with speech/language impairments.
    • To assist teacher(s) of the hearing impaired in monitoring hearing aids.
    • To participate in annual review and evaluation of the progress of students with speech/language impairments.
    • To make presentations as requested.
    • To complete and submit reports in a timely manner as required by law, the West Virginia Department of Education and/or the county Board of Education.
    • To report the presence of any situation that may be harmful to the health and safety of the students and/or staff.
    • To identify and refer for screening and evaluation any child who has other learning deficiencies.
    • To advise the principal of the presence of any situation that may require immediate intervention so as not to hinder the instructional program.
    • To accept responsibility for the behavior of students assigned.
    • To supervise students at all times in accordance with state, county and school policies.
    • To attend all faculty senate and other required meetings.
    • To fulfill annual continuing education requirements and attend other required training programs.
    • To maintain professional work habits.
    • To maintain and upgrade professional skills.
    • To perform other duties as assigned by the school principal or the Director of Special Programs.
